Simy to earn ₦480m/year as he joins newly-promoted Serie A side US Salernitana

The newly-promoted side have bolstered their attacking options by signing the Nigerian international ahead of their return to the top-flight

Super Eagles star Simy Nwankwo has joined newly-promoted Serie A side Salernitana from Crotone on an initial loan deal with an obligation to buy for €6m.

A statement on Salernitana’s website read: The US Salernitana 1919 announces that it has reached an agreement with FC Crotone for the temporary transfer with the obligation to redeem the striker class ’92 Simeon Tochukwu Nwankwo. The player will wear the number 25 shirt.

According to Sky Italia per Football Italia, the Nigerian star is expected to earn €1m (₦480m) a year and a sign-on fee.

Crotone will also get 10% of future sales. The 29-year-old has been a target for The Garnets all summer as they prepare for life in Italy’s top-flight for the first time in 23 years.

It’s not hard to see why they’ve pulled all the stops to get the former Gil Vicente star after he scored 20 league goals in Italy’s top-flight last season.

The Super Eagles star achieved this incredible feat in a Crotone team with just five Serie A wins all season. Salernitana will now hope Simy can replicate the same form as they prepare to compete with the best this season.

They open their Serie A campaign with a trip to Bologna on Sunday.
